Fascinating new paper on the economics of mental health by Marieke Bos, Andreas Hertzberg, and Andres Liberman: when Swedish men get a diagnosis of a mental illness at age 18, this leads to increased unemployment, illness, and death later in life. drive.google.com/file/d/1KLxcvH…


FINDING: Upon receiving large cash payments, average productivity among poor workers increases while mistakes decline, which suggests that alleviating financial concerns can make workers more attentive and productive. New from Supreet Kaur, 𝐒𝐞𝐧𝐝𝐡𝐢𝐥 𝐌𝐮𝐥𝐥𝐚𝐢𝐧𝐚𝐭𝐡𝐚𝐧, Suanna Oh, @FrankSchilbach:
